<h3>What is the Arithmetic Sequence?</h3>
We are going to use the arithmetic sequence formula since we require the previous term in a sequence.
The arithmetic sequence formula is;
aₙ = a + (n − 1)d,
where;
a is the first term of the sequence
n is the position of the term in the sequence
d is the common difference
aₙ is the nth term of the sequence.
Our sequence is 10, 14, 18, 22 up to row 20.
Using the sequence formula;
a_20 = 10 + (20 − 1)4.
a_20 = 10 + (19* 4)
a_20 = 10 + 76
a_20 = 86.
Thus, the number of seats in row 20 was 86 seats.
